creamery

6 senses · Free VividLex dictionary · Thesaurus

  1. 1. n. A place where butter and cheese are made, or where milk and cream are put up in cans for market. Source: opted
  2. 2. n. A place or apparatus in which milk is set for raising cream. Source: opted
  3. 3. n. An establishment where cream is sold. Source: opted
  4. 4. n. a workplace where dairy products (butter and cheese etc.) are produced or sold Source: wordnet
